大开测试:性能-如何使用自动关联对测试结果进行分析(连载28)

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了大开测试:性能-如何使用自动关联对测试结果进行分析(连载28)相关的知识,希望对你有一定的参考价值。

7.28  如何使用自动关联对测试结果进行分析

1.问题提出

如何使用自动关联对测试结果进行分析?

2.问题解答

通过分析网页细分图或者使用自动关联功能确定造成服务器或网络瓶颈的原因。自动关联功能应用高级统计信息算法来确定哪些度量对事务的响应时间影响最大,从而确定系统的性能瓶颈。下面我们结合图7-61,来实例讲解以下如何应用自动关联来分析测试结果。

在图7-61上我们发现SubmitData事务的响应时间相对较长(为了方便大家看清楚该曲线,作者用粗线条对SubmitData曲线进行了重画)。要将此事务与场景或会话步骤运行期间收集的所有度量关联,请右键单击SubmitData事务,在弹出的菜单中选择“Auto Correlate”项,弹出自动关联对话框,选择要检查的时间段,以及单击“Correlation Options”选项卡,选择要将哪些图的数据与SubmitData事务关联,如图7-62和图7-63所示。

技术分享                         技术分享

                图7-61  平均事务响应时间图                                          图7-62  自动关联对话框

结合SubmitData选择与其紧密关联的5个度量,此关联示例描述下面的数据库和Web服务器度量对SubmitData事务的影响最大,如图7-64所示。

l  Number of Deadlocks/sec (SQL Server)。

l  JVMHeapSizeCurrent (WebLogic Server)。

l  PendingRequestCurrentCount (WebLogic Server)。

选择的这些图的数据与Submit Data事务关联技术分享

图7-63  关联选项页对话框

l  WaitingForConnectionCurrentCount (WebLogic Server)。

l  Private Bytes (Process_Total) (SQL Server)。

使用相应的服务器图,可以查看上面每一个服务器度量的数据并查明导致系统中出现瓶颈的问题。

例如,图7-65描述WebLogic(JMX)应用程序服务器度量JVMHeapSizeCurrent和Private Bytes(Process_Total)随着运行的Vuser数量的增加而增加。因此,图7-64描述这两种度量会导致WebLogic(JMX)应用程序服务器的性能下降,从而影响SubmitData事务的响应时间。技术分享                 技术分享

图7-64  与SubmitData关联的5个度量                               图7-65  WebLogic(JMX)-运行Vuser图


更多信息请关注大开科技公众号或官方网站

www.dakaikeji.com.cn

技术分享


以上是关于大开测试:性能-如何使用自动关联对测试结果进行分析(连载28)的主要内容,如果未能解决你的问题,请参考以下文章

大开测试:性能-如何实现对数据服务器的监控(连载24)

大开测试:性能-如何在Analysis图表中添加分析注释(连载26)

大开测试:性能-如何确定登录达到响应时间为3秒的指标(连载27)

大开测试:性能-如何解决由于设置引起的运行失败问题(连载22)

大开测试:性能- 基于目标和手动场景测试有何联系和不同(连载20)

大开测试:性能- 基于目标和手动场景测试有何联系和不同(连载20)